RE: The tariff classification of Shrek ® Fun Casting Combo from China

Dear Ms. Cumins:

In your letter dated November 15, 2006, on behalf of your client, Bimini Bay Outfitters Ltd., you requested a tariff classification ruling.

You are requesting the tariff classification on a product called Shrek ® Fun Casting Combo. There is no designated style number for the product. The item, a toy fishing rod, is a hard plastic rod with fishing line that can be attached to the soft plastics casting plug. The article is designed to teach children to fish who may not have the fine motor skills required. The sample will be returned, as requested by your office.

The applicable subheading for the Shrek ® Fun Casting Combo will be 9503.90.0080,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for Other toys; reduced-size ("scale") models and similar recreational models, working or not; puzzles of all kinds; parts and accessories thereof: Other: Other. The rate of duty will be Free.
